    Check the inventory level of the components.  If your materials are not available in inventory the system will give the "Nothing to Handle" error, which means you do not have enough inventory to generate the Pick.
     
    Another place to see this is the Pick Worksheet.  You can "Get Documents" and filter to your Assembly Order.  The system will calculate what is available and list each material line in the worksheet.  It will show you what your Qty. Available to Pick is.  If it is zero, you will not be able to create the Pick.
     
    Lastly, in your Warehouse Setup, turn on the Stop and Show Error Messages, which may give you more information.

    nothing to handle could be caused by different reasons, the most common one, as it been pointed out, is insufficient qty of items to pick even though it seems there are enough stock. 
     
    a quick to check is use the bin content as below. the white location is a directed location, and the item only has 12 as available even the on hand qty shows more.
     
    There are many reasons why the available qty is less than the on hand qty. To put it simply, BC reserves qty of item in various situations such as hard reservation, items on pick lines but not handled yet etc.
